Uganda Cranes Skipper Denis Onyango has added his voice on the on-going ‘cold war’ in the Uganda Cranes camp over pay as   legendary goalkeeper has threatened to quit the national team over alleged corruption by Moses Magogo led Federation of Uganda Football Associations (FUFA).

In an audio recording making rounds on social media, Onyango hinted he may not take part in the 2022 World Cup qualifiers following recent comments from Magogo.

Magogo said cranes players who featured in Chan qualifiers played “sh**tty” football and should not demand for any money.

In response, Onyango said; “I am really tired of making money for those Fufa guys, let him (Magogo) start another team and we see those who do not play ’sh**ty’ football and make the money for him.”

“I do not know who will play for him (Magogo) in the World Cup qualifiers because I do not have the time for that.

“Mutyaba (Mike) has just exposed them, yes they embezzle players’ funds that is the truth because national team players were supposed to be paid one million shillings each monthly but all in vain,” he added.

Onyango’s leaked audio comes a week after retired cranes player Mike Mutyaba has been ranting on social media over unpaid allowances for Cranes players by the Magogo led federation.
